Who We AreDEVELON, headquartered in Suwanee, Georgia, markets the DEVELON brand of products which includes crawler excavators, wheel excavators, mini excavators, wheel loaders, articulated dump trucks, material handlers, log loaders, and attachments. With more than 200 equipment dealer locations in North America, DEVELON is known for its unmatched dedication to service, customer uptime, and durable, reliable products. What You'll DoThe Dealer Development Manager’s main objective is to execute DEVELON’s channel development strategy as it pertains to both compact and heavy core products. This includes a specific focus on dealer prospecting and setup that will achieve the business's channel coverage and expansion goals. In addition, work with targeted dealers to focus on growth and/or improvement opportunities.
Candidates should currently reside in the Atlanta Metro Area to collaborate with the Development Department as well as other departments that frequently strategize together. This position should be viewed as a traveling job with 25% or more travel time. Frequent, regular travel within North America is required.
Dealer Recruitment- Assist with developing the recruitment strategy. Execute strategy relative to channel development.
- Prospect and sign new dealer locations with a focus on achieving expansion goals.
- Gain commitment from new dealers on minimum inventory stocking requirements and performance commitments.
- Develop a written business plan in conjunction with dealers intending to expand as well as new dealers looking to join the DEVELON dealer network.
- Have a good understanding of dealer performance and profitability metrics.
- Clear and transparent communication with cross‑functional stakeholders.
- Assist or take control of new dealer set‑up, onboarding, and training.
- Assist new dealer setup and development of new locations to improve sales and product offers.
- Identify market gaps, coverage needs, and development priorities across a territory.
- Support existing dealer termination, coverage, and succession planning scenarios through dealer prospecting efforts and coordination with dealers and company District and Regional Sales Managers.
- Support dealer agreement execution, renewals, territory alignments and ownership transitions.
- Regularly analyze the national and regional performance of DEVELON dealers and competition.
- Identify key focus items for improvement and assist in developing improvement or expansion plans depending on appropriate needs.
- Clear directional guidance to leadership and other stakeholders of preferred direction and follow‑up plan.
- Continued promotion and education of dealers and District and Regional Sales Managers through participation in dealer meetings, region meetings, and other sessions that afford the opportunity to communicate the vision.
- Support dealer expansion and strategy through interaction with dealers and District and Regional Sales Managers and the continued development and communication of business modeling and planning tools.
- Support dealers and District and Regional Sales Managers on opportunities in the area of capital, stocking, and succession planning.
